Announced in 2020, Final Fantasy XVI takes place in Valisthea, a location in the middle of the two continents, Ash and Storm. Developers took inspiration from medieval Europe to create the upcoming game\u2019s setting. Square Enix added to the hype surrounding the RPG by displaying Final Fantasy XVI\u2019s various environments, including cliffs and waterfalls. Initially, fans assumed they would receive a PC version of Final Fantasy XVI after six months of PlayStation 5 exclusivity. As revealed by Naoki Yoshida\u2019s comments, that appeared to be no longer the case. Despite the ongoing challenge of purchasing the console, the RPG\u2019s director and producer had a simple suggestion. Yoshida encouraged players to \u201cbuy a PlayStation 5\u201d instead of waiting for a nonexistent FFXVI PC port.
